Copper-plated safety wire bolts are specialized fasteners designed for applications where vibration resistance and corrosion protection are critical. Here’s an overall description of their features and uses:
主な特徴
-
Material & Plating:
-
Typically made from carbon steel, stainless steel, or alloy steel for strength.
-
Copper-plated for enhanced corrosion resistance, electrical conductivity, and lubricity during installation.
-
-
Safety Wire Holes:
-
Feature pre-drilled holes (usually two) in the bolt head or shank to allow for safety wire (lock wire) installation.
-
The wire prevents loosening due to vibration or rotation.

-
-
Thread Type:
-
Often have fine threads for better tension control and vibration resistance.
-
Common thread standards include UNC, UNF, or metric.
-
-
Head Styles:
-
Available in hex head, clevis head, or drilled head designs depending on the application.
-
-
Standards & Grades:
-
Manufactured to meet ANSI, MS (Military Standard), NAS (National Aerospace Standard), or DIN specifications.
-
High-strength grades (e.g., Grade 5, Grade 8, or A286 for aerospace).

Installation Notes:
-
Safety wire must be threaded correctly (typically in a double-twist method) to prevent loosening.
-
Proper torque must be applied before wiring to avoid overloading the bolt.
